Was ist ein Headless CMS?
Ein Headless CMS (Content Management System) trennt die Backend-Content-Verwaltung von der Frontend-Darstellung. Im Gegensatz zu traditionellen CMS wie WordPress oder Joomla liefert ein Headless CMS Inhalte über APIs aus, sodass sie flexibel in verschiedenen Anwendungen genutzt werden können.
Diese Struktur ermöglicht es, Inhalte gleichzeitig auf Websites, Apps oder anderen digitalen Plattformen bereitzustellen. Durch die API-gestützte Bereitstellung entfällt die klassische Template-Engine, was Entwicklern mehr Freiheit bei der Gestaltung und Integration bietet.
Wann lohnt sich der Umstieg auf ein Headless CMS?
Ein Wechsel zu einem Headless CMS kann viele Vorteile bringen, aber er ist nicht für jedes Unternehmen notwendig. Die Entscheidung hängt von mehreren Faktoren ab, darunter technische Anforderungen, Skalierbarkeit und zukünftige Digitalisierungspläne.
Flexible Inhaltsausgabe auf verschiedenen Kanälen
Ein großer Vorteil eines Headless CMS ist die Möglichkeit, Inhalte auf verschiedenen Plattformen gleichzeitig bereitzustellen. Unternehmen, die mehrere digitale Kanäle bespielen – wie Websites, mobile Apps, Smartwatches oder IoT-Geräte – profitieren besonders von dieser Technologie.
- Content kann zentral verwaltet und auf mehreren Plattformen genutzt werden.
- Aktualisierungen müssen nur einmal vorgenommen werden und sind sofort überall verfügbar.
- Integration mit neuen Technologien oder Geräten ist einfacher.
Höhere Performance und bessere Skalierbarkeit
Ein Headless CMS ist oft leistungsfähiger als traditionelle CMS-Lösungen, da es keine unnötige Frontend-Last mit sich bringt. Inhalte werden über API-Endpunkte ausgeliefert, was eine schnellere Ladezeit und eine bessere Performance gewährleistet.
Besonders große Unternehmen oder Plattformen mit hohem Traffic profitieren von dieser verbesserten Skalierbarkeit. Durch die Trennung von Backend und Frontend können Entwickler zudem unabhängig voneinander arbeiten, was die Entwicklungsprozesse beschleunigt.
Bessere Entwicklerfreundlichkeit
Im Gegensatz zu monolithischen CMS bietet ein Headless CMS Entwicklern mehr Freiheit bei der Wahl von Technologien und Frameworks. Sie sind nicht an bestimmte Frontend-Strukturen gebunden und können moderne Technologien wie React, Vue.js oder Angular ohne Einschränkungen nutzen.
Das erleichtert die Integration in bestehende Systeme und erlaubt eine individuellere Gestaltung der Benutzeroberfläche. Unternehmen, die auf innovative Webtechnologien setzen, können so flexibler auf Veränderungen reagieren.
Nachteile eines Headless CMS
Trotz der vielen Vorteile gibt es auch Herausforderungen bei der Nutzung eines Headless CMS. Besonders Unternehmen ohne dediziertes Entwicklerteam sollten sich über mögliche Nachteile bewusst sein.
Höherer Implementierungsaufwand
Im Vergleich zu traditionellen CMS benötigt ein Headless CMS eine aufwendigere Implementierung. Während Systeme wie WordPress oft ohne technisches Know-how eingerichtet werden können, erfordert ein Headless CMS eine tiefere Entwicklungsarbeit.
Dies bedeutet in der Regel höhere initiale Kosten und einen längeren Entwicklungsprozess. Unternehmen ohne eigene Entwickler müssen häufig externe Agenturen oder Freelancer engagieren.
Kein integriertes Frontend
Da ein Headless CMS nur die Inhalte bereitstellt, gibt es keine integrierte Möglichkeit zur Darstellung. Das Frontend muss separat entwickelt werden, wodurch zusätzliche Ressourcen und technisches Wissen erforderlich sind.
- Kein fertiges Design oder Theme verfügbar.
- Erweiterungen und Plugins müssen oft individuell programmiert werden.
- Redakteure benötigen oft Schulungen zur Nutzung der neuen Systeme.
Welche Headless CMS-Optionen gibt es?
Es gibt eine Vielzahl von Headless CMS-Lösungen auf dem Markt, die sich in Funktionen, Kosten und Hosting-Optionen unterscheiden. Je nach Anforderungen und Budget können Unternehmen zwischen Open-Source- und kommerziellen Lösungen wählen.
Open-Source Headless CMS
Open-Source-Optionen bieten maximale Flexibilität und keine laufenden Lizenzkosten. Sie erfordern allerdings technisches Know-how für die Implementierung und Wartung.
- Strapi: Ein beliebtes Open-Source-Headless-CMS mit einer intuitiven Benutzeroberfläche und flexiblen APIs.
- Directus: Eine leistungsstarke Open-Source-Lösung, die sich für datenbankgesteuerte Inhalte eignet.
- Ghost: Ursprünglich ein Blogging-CMS, das mittlerweile als Headless-Option genutzt werden kann.
Kommerzielle Headless CMS
Kommerzielle Lösungen bieten oft mehr Support, Skalierbarkeit und umfangreiche Funktionen. Sie sind ideal für Unternehmen, die eine zuverlässige und wartungsarme Lösung suchen.
- Contentful: Eine der bekanntesten Headless-CMS-Plattformen mit leistungsstarken APIs und Cloud-Hosting.
- Sanity: Bietet eine flexible Datenstruktur und eine anpassbare Editoroberfläche.
- Storyblok: Kombiniert Headless-Funktionalität mit visueller Bearbeitung für eine bessere Redakteurs-Erfahrung.
Fazit: Wann lohnt sich der Umstieg?
Der Wechsel zu einem Headless CMS lohnt sich vor allem für Unternehmen, die Inhalte über mehrere Plattformen hinweg ausspielen möchten. Auch für Entwicklerteams, die moderne Technologien nutzen und flexible Architekturen bevorzugen, bietet ein Headless CMS klare Vorteile.
Allerdings sollte der höhere Implementierungsaufwand nicht unterschätzt werden. Unternehmen ohne technisches Personal müssen sich entweder externe Unterstützung holen oder auf ein kommerzielles Headless CMS mit Support setzen.
Wer langfristig auf Skalierbarkeit, Performance und Flexibilität setzt, wird mit einem Headless CMS jedoch eine zukunftssichere Lösung finden. Eine Analyse der eigenen Anforderungen und Ressourcen hilft dabei, die richtige Entscheidung zu treffen.